Summary
The bill transfers $170 million from the state’s General Fund into five earmarked funds for outdoor equity, research, site readiness, development training, and local economic development. It also appropriates roughly $124 million for the Economic Development Department and state universities to support advanced‑energy, defense, bioscience, aerospace, AI and quantum initiatives. The money is intended to create start‑ups, research hubs, and training programs, with any unspent balances returning to the General Fund after FY 2029.
